    10 Tips To Start a Successful Fleet Management Business

    Blackbird News TeamBy Blackbird News TeamApril 26, 2023No Comments6 Mins Read
    Share
    Facebook Twitter LinkedIn WhatsApp Pinterest Email Telegram

    Launching a fleet management company can be a profitable venture for anyone who is experienced in the industry. However, like any successful business, it also demands hard work and dedication. You cannot simply start your business and see results immediately, even if you are a recognized name within the industry. There is every possibility you will need to start from the bottom and gradually build your reputation to ensure success. With this in mind, you would benefit from these ten tips to start a successful fleet management business. 

    Know What You Want 

    The foundation of any successful business is knowing your goals. Before deciding on a brand name and logo, you must consider what you want from this venture. 

    Ask yourself about your target audience, how you will get investment and where you will be based. These are just a few questions you must ask, but they are all vital for helping you hit the ground running. 

    Establishing these elements before you do anything else will make the next steps easier and give you the momentum you need to thrive. 

    Make Sure You Comply

    Compliance is always essential when launching a business. With fleet management, you need to take this even further. Since your employees will operate heavy machinery, you need to outline risk and safety protocols that will protect them and your business. 

    Of course, health and safety is not the only compliance issue you need to consider. Modern businesses need to think about their environmental impact as well as provide equal opportunities for their employees. It’s always best to highlight these as early as possible and find solutions to avoid any issues. 

    Use the Right Software 

    Every business relies on technology to simplify its processes and procedures. The right software can help you track your fleet, arrange which drivers are doing what, and ensure you provide the best customer service possible. 

    There are many fleet management software options available for you to select depending on your needs. As a small business, you may not need all the bells and whistles immediately. Still, high-quality tracking and management software is something to consider once you have established your brand. 

    Research the Best Expense Tracking 

    Since your drivers will be away from HQ for extended periods, you should identify how to track their expenses. Tracking expenses is not because you don’t trust your drivers, but more so you can budget appropriately to ensure your company stays afloat.

    Find the Best Drivers and Operators 

    The process of choosing your fleet drivers is arguably the most vital element of building a successful fleet. You cannot simply choose any driver. They must have experience operating large trucks while also being confident behind the wheel and navigating tight or busy roads. 

    It’s worth carrying out substantial background checks that will provide more details about your candidates and ensure you can make an informed decision that will benefit your business and establish respect early. 

    Learn How to Make the Most Of Operational Costs 

    Every business must handle operational costs successfully to prevent severe budget issues and other problems. If you are not confident in working with money, outsource your financial requirements to freelance accountants, as this allows you to focus on other aspects of your business. 

    When considering a fleet management business, you may have to deal with more operational costs compared to the average company. Since you use large trucks on the road, there is an increased risk of accidents and damage. Finding good insurance can soften the blow should something happen. 

    Seek Out Loans to Stabilize Your Finances 

    Many businesses require early loans to help get the company off the ground. If you speak to other fleet management entrepreneurs, they will tell you that loans can be hugely beneficial in stabilizing your finances as you begin building your company. 

    This need primarily surrounds the actual fleet. Vehicles are expensive to rent and purchase, so you will need substantial capital to make it easy for you to start your business. As long as you demonstrate the potential for profitability, a loan (or even an investment) should not be too complicated. 

    Embrace Automation 

    Business owners want to do everything themselves, but they will quickly realize they cannot do it all and manage to sleep, eat, and have a life. Automation can take care of smaller, more mundane aspects of your business. There are various options for you to explore that can segment different drivers and book appointments without human interaction, which will help to streamline your business early on and set the tone for consistency and success. 

    Use Data And Analytics 

    You should also make the most of data and analytics for insights that can help you boost your brand and profile. The information gained from this approach can help improve your website and social media marketing, which will attract more business. It can also help to highlight any delays or issues with your deliveries. The more information you have, the easier it becomes to make effective changes that benefit your business, drivers, and customers. 

    Determine Your Initial Routes and Range

    You must be careful about how ambitious you are when you launch your company. While you want to reach every customer in the country, this may not be possible with a small fleet. Instead, it’s best to operate on a smaller range initially (at least for the first year or two) before you focus on expansion. Gradually, you will raise your profile, reach more clients, and have the funds to invest in a larger fleet to meet needs all over the country and maybe even internationally. 

    Summing Up 

    Fleet management is an excellent career to consider, especially if you are familiar with the industry and have an array of existing contacts and networking opportunities. If you feel it’s time to branch out on your own, these tips will make your company launch successfully and can help guarantee profit and respect from clients and competing businesses alike.
